§ 46-5-78 — Bylaws of cooperative generally
Georgia·Title 46
The board of directors shall adopt the first bylaws of a cooperative to be adopted following an incorporation, conversion, combined consolidation and conversion, merger, or consolidation. Thereafter, the board of directors shall have the power to alter, amend, or repeal the bylaws, or adopt new bylaws, unless such power is reserved exclusively to the members of the cooperative by this part, the articles of incorporation, or bylaws previously adopted by the members; provided, however, that any bylaws adopted by the board of directors may be altered, amended, or repealed and new bylaws may be adopted by the members.
